Understand the Symbolism Behind Flowers
Flowers have long been associated with emotions and sentiments. Knowing their meanings allows you to convey your feelings thoughtfully.
- Roses: The quintessential flower of romance. Red roses symbolize passionate love, while pink expresses admiration and gratitude. White roses stand for purity and new beginnings.
- Tulips: These vibrant blooms are ideal for declarations of love. Red tulips are particularly associated with deep affection, while yellow tulips signify cheerfulness and hope.
- Orchids: Known for their exotic beauty, orchids represent refinement, strength, and admiration—perfect for a sophisticated expression of love.
By aligning the meaning of the flower with your intent, your gift becomes a heartfelt expression rather than a simple gesture.

Choose Colors with Care
Color plays a significant role in the emotional impact of a floral arrangement. Each hue carries a unique sentiment, making it an essential consideration in your selection process.
- Red: Represents love and passion, perfect for anniversaries or Valentine’s Day.
- Pink: Expresses admiration, gentleness, and appreciation, making it a versatile choice.
- White: Conveys purity, innocence, and new beginnings—ideal for romantic gestures in budding relationships.
- Purple: Associated with royalty and admiration, it’s a striking option for expressing deep respect and passion.
Selecting the right color palette ensures that your flowers convey the intended emotions beautifully.
Consider Fragrance for a Sensory Experience
A bouquet’s fragrance adds an enchanting layer to the gift. Choosing flowers with a pleasant aroma can create a sensory experience that lingers in memory.
- Lavender: Its calming and soothing scent complements romantic settings.
- Gardenias: Known for their intoxicating fragrance, they symbolize purity and love.
- Lilies: Particularly oriental lilies, offer a captivating scent that enhances their aesthetic appeal.
Balancing visual beauty with an alluring fragrance creates a holistic gift that appeals to the heart and senses alike.

Seasonality Matters
Seasonal blooms often offer the freshest, most vibrant options while also showcasing an appreciation for the time of year.
- Spring: Daffodils and tulips bring vibrancy and renewal.
- Summer: Sunflowers and hydrangeas radiate warmth and cheerfulness.
- Autumn: Chrysanthemums and dahlias provide rich, earthy tones.
- Winter: Amaryllis and poinsettias offer a festive touch.
Aligning your floral choice with the season not only ensures quality but also reflects an awareness of the natural beauty around you.
